Dig a hole on the ground to design a photovoltaic bracket
Installation starts by digging a hole to a specified depth and shape, bracing a steel pole in the center, and pouring cement to ground level. A single-pole mount will require only one foundation, while a multi-pole mount will need one foundation for every pole. Although they do a big job, MT Solar. . Since traditional ground-based rigid photovoltaic supports have certain site restrictions, a large-span flexible photovoltaic support structure composed of a prestressed cable system has been increasingly used in recent years.
